Summary
Pledges support for Distracted Driving Awareness Month in April 2022 and strongly urges the citizens and businesses of Illinois to observe Distracted Driving Awareness Month by practicing safe driving behaviors and pledging to drive distraction-free.
Title
DISTRACTED DRIVING MONTH
